make login on authorize actually work and redirect back to the authorize form after...
[authserver.git] / token.php
index 31bb0cca959877e3db4949fa6ec7b4c110eacc0a..e3cf8ffa715081a14136643d597a4cd463da87f1 100644 (file)
--- a/token.php
+++ b/token.php
@@ -3,10 +3,11 @@
  * License, v. 2.0. If a copy of the MPL was not distributed with this file,
  * You can obtain one at http://mozilla.org/MPL/2.0/. */
 
-// Simple server based on https://bshaffer.github.io/oauth2-server-php-docs/cookbook
+// Called with e.g. curl .../token -d 'grant_type=authorization_code&client_id=testclient&client_secret=testpass&code=&state=f00bar&redirect_uri=http%3A%2F%2Ffake.example.com%2F'
+// Response is always JSON.
 
-// include our OAuth2 Server object
-require_once __DIR__.'/server.php';
+// Include the common auth system files (including the OAuth2 Server object).
+require_once(__DIR__.'/authsystem.inc.php');
 
 // Handle a request for an OAuth2.0 Access Token and send the response to the client
 $server->handleTokenRequest(OAuth2\Request::createFromGlobals())->send();